What if the past could reach back?When archaeologist Caleb Nash and historian Ava Mercer uncover a sealed chamber in the hills outside Jerusalem, they find something that defies explanation - an ancient oil lamp that has waited two thousand years to be found. By the right people. At the right moment.In an instant they are torn from everything familiar and dropped into the most consequential time in human history - first century Judea, one year before the crucifixion. A world of dust and danger where survival is not guaranteed and nothing in their carefully constructed secular lives has prepared them for what they are about to encounter.To survive they must depend on each other completely.To find their way home they must follow a road they never chose.And somewhere on that road - in a crowded city during an ancient feast, in a small lamplit room, in the words of a man from Nazareth that no one who heard them ever forgot - two people who never believed in anything beyond what they could prove will discover that the greatest evidence of all has been waiting for them all along.Some roads find you. This one will change you.
